Reasons To Call a Taylor HVAC Company

Heating and cooling systems in Taylor work year-round to handle freezing temperatures and summer humidity. When equipment starts underperforming, making unusual sounds or driving up energy bills, calling a local HVAC company quickly can prevent larger mechanical failures and restore reliable comfort.

Heating Issues

  • Furnace burner not staying lit: Flame sensor contamination or gas supply issues may interrupt heating cycles.
  • Cracked furnace blower wheel: Can reduce airflow and create vibration or noise.
  • High-efficiency furnace error codes: Pressure switch faults or condensate drainage problems may be present.
  • Noisy boiler circulating pump: Worn bearings or air in the system can affect heat distribution.
  • Heat pump defrost cycle not activating: Sensor failure or control board malfunction may cause ice buildup.
  • Garage heater not producing heat: Ignition problems or gas line pressure issues can restrict output.

Cooling & AC Issues

  • AC unit humming but not starting: Hard start kit failure or locked compressor.
  • Central air uneven cooling between floors: Duct balancing issues or zoning control problems.
  • Mini-split not responding to remote: Communication board or signal interference issues.
  • Refrigerant leak in evaporator coil: Corrosion or vibration damage may reduce cooling capacity.
  • AC breaker tripping repeatedly: Electrical short, capacitor failure or compressor strain.
  • Condensation forming on supply ducts: High humidity levels or insufficient insulation.
  • Two-stage AC not shifting speeds: Thermostat compatibility or control wiring problems.

General HVAC Problems

  • Air handler leaking water: Clogged condensate drain line or cracked drain pan.
  • Whole-house humidifier not turning on: Solenoid valve failure or wiring issue.
  • Poor airflow after filter replacement: Incorrect filter size or overly restrictive MERV rating.
  • Ductwork popping noises: Metal expansion due to static pressure changes.
  • Thermostat calibration drift: Temperature readings not matching actual indoor conditions.
  • Ventilation fan running continuously: Relay issues or control board malfunction.
  • Indoor air smells musty after system startup: Mold growth inside coils or ductwork.

The Best Residential HVAC System for Taylor Homes

The ideal HVAC system for a Taylor home depends on property size, insulation quality and Wayne County’s seasonal temperature swings. Winter lows typically range from 16–22°F, while summer highs reach 82–87°F with humid conditions. With the average Taylor home measuring roughly 1,650 square feet, a properly sized high-efficiency furnace paired with central air conditioning or an energy-efficient heat pump system supports dependable comfort throughout the year. Precise load calculations improve airflow balance, increase efficiency and help extend equipment lifespan.
